WebOct 9, 2024 · 1. Overview. This article is an introduction to Lettuce, a Redis Java client. Redis is an in-memory key-value store that can be used as a database, cache or message broker. Data is added, queried, modified, and deleted with commands that operate on keys in Redis' in-memory data structure.

WebSometimes known as Corn Salad, lamb's lettuce has long spoon-shaped dark leaves and a distinctive, tangy flavour. It is used raw in salads as well as steamed and served as a vegetable. The unusual name reputedly comes from the lettuce's resemblance to the size and shape of a lamb's tongue. Availability
